The Rainbow club managed to beat Heart of Lions 3-2 in a club friendly at the Pobiman Sports Complex.
Defender Christopher Bonney opened the score for the Phobians with a stunning free-kick on the 37th minute of the game.
Two minutes later, Samuel Agbenega levelled the score for the Kpando-based club to end the first half in a one-all draw.
After recess, the Ghana Premier League side continued to dominate the match with brilliant passes and fearsome attacks on the back line of Lions.
Former Hasaacas striker Anthony Quayson restored the lead for Coach Kim Grant's side on the hour mark.
Newly signed attacker Kofi Kordzi netted his third goal for Hearts of Oak on the 82nd minute of the game.
A late goal from Sule Musah wasn't enough for the Division One League side as the match ended in a 3-2 win in favor of Hearts of Oak.
Hearts of Oak will travel to face lower-tier side Pacific Heroes in a friendly on Sunday.
